Benefits

For developing member countries (DMCs), ADB's official cofinancing operations
  • maximize the impact of development assistance through coordination of projects with complementary or synergistic benefits
  • avoid duplication of effort and promote a consistent approach to development assistance by funding institutions
  • expand availability of concessional and nonconcessional development assistance, particularly for DMCs that have yet to gain direct access to commercial financing
For official funding agencies, ADB's official cofinancing operations
  • maximize the impact of each dollar of development assistance, since ADB coordinates its projects with those of cofinanciers that offer complementary or synergistic benefits
  • avoid duplication of effort and promote a consistent approach to development assistance
  • share the results of ADB's project feasibility studies with cofinanciers
  • share project information with cofinanciers during implementation to help realize the expected benefits of cofinancing
  • for untied cofinancing, provide cofinanciers with ADB administration and supervision services (for both loans and grants)
